>         YANG Model for QoS

>

>         QoS is a very general concept for me, seeeing it more in the

context of

>         system and application performance rather than just network so

I would

>         like something in the title to make it clear that this is

'only'

>         routing;  ditto - especially - the Abstract.  Current RFC have

something

>         in the title that makes this clear.

>

>         s.1

>         (NMDA) [RFC8342 [RFC8342]].

>         looks odd with [[ ]]

>

>         YANG has conditionals which many modellers overuse (IMHO:-)

>         Here I would like more.  You twice have min and max and so

could require

>         that max> or >=  min.  Is it valid to have the one value, ie

min = max,

>         or just a min?

>

>         contact (times seven)

>              contact

>                "WG Web:   <http://tools.ietf.org/wg/rtgwg/><https://tools.ietf.org/wg/rtgwg/%3E>

>                 WG List:  <mailto:rtgwg@ietf.org>

>                 WG Chair: Chris Bowers

>                           <mailto:cbowers@juniper.net>

>                 WG Chair: Jeff Tantsura

>                           <mailto:jefftant.ietf@gmail.com>

>         should not have the WG chair therein- they are too ephemeral

! - just

>         web, list, editors

>

>         There is a mismatch between the editors of the I-D and those

of the YANG

>         modules; is this intended?

>

>         References in the YANG module - I would like more! e.g.

>           identity one-rate-two-color-meter-type {

>                base meter-type;

>                description

>                  "one rate two color meter type";

>              }

>              identity one-rate-tri-color-meter-type { ...

>                 reference  "RFC2697: A Single Rate Three Color

Marker";

>              identity two-rate-tri-color-meter-type { ...

>                reference    "RFC2698: A Two Rate Three Color Marker";

>

>         while some modules lack any such references for the identity;

needs to

>         be consistent

>

>         or, still on Reference,

>

>              grouping protocol-cfg {

>                list protocol-cfg { key "protocol-min protocol-max";

>                  description  "list of ranges of protocol values";

>

>         which I read as being IPv4 only - IPv6 does not have protocol!

Perhaps

>         a name change or explanatory note plus a reference to the IANA

website.

>

>

>                    choice drop-algorithm {

>         has only one case; if intended, an explanatory note would be

useful

>

>

>              augment "/if:interfaces/if:interface" {

>         is unqualified so this will be added to all interfaces in the

box; I am

>         unclear if this is a good idea.
